    What's important about the New Year?

    1. During the Chinese New Year, you can't say unlucky words, whether you scold others, or others scold you, as long as you scold others first, it may be that your luck for a year is not good, and it is not good for health, we all know that the New Year is an important day, so why can't you celebrate the Spring Festival in harmony, the so-called harmony generates wealth. It also includes not hitting children, quarrelling, swearing, cursing or swearing, breaking things, sickness, death or disability, and other words that are unlucky as long as they are unlucky, and they are not allowed to say or do them during the Chinese New Year. In this way, you can ensure a happy and healthy new year, a good start to the new year, and good luck will accompany you.

    2. It is best not to sweep the floor or take out the garbage, otherwise it may sweep away your good fortune, if you really want to clean the room, sweep the floor from the outside to the inside, wrap the garbage, etc., and dispose of it or take it out after the fifth day of the first month.

    3. There is a saying that you don't take a bath or wash clothes on the morning of the first day of the new year, so that you won't wash away your wealth.

    4. On the first day of the Lunar New Year, the daughter can not go back to her parents' house, otherwise it will be unfavorable to her mother's family, because the daughter should be at her husband's house for the New Year when she gets married.

    5. In some areas, it is not allowed to fry kueh before the fifth day of the Lunar New Year, because the fried kueh will be red, which means that it will scatter wealth.

    6. Before the fifth day of the Lunar New Year, you can not take needles and sharp weapons, which is intended to make the hostess who has worked hard for a year can have a good rest, and there is another custom that you can not eat chicken heads or feet before the fifth day of the Lunar New Year, which means that the New Year can have a head and a tail.

    The New Year is exquisite. 7. You can't look at the evaporated kueh, otherwise the evaporation will not be able to evaporate, which will affect the fortune of the whole family. It is also forbidden to give away kueh as it is unlucky.

    8. Pay attention to not crying during the Chinese New Year, so as not to encounter bad things in the new year.

    9. During the Chinese New Year, it is best not to have injections, surgeries, or seek medical treatment, in fact, the purpose is very clear, that is, to pray for good health in the new year.

    10. You can't collect debts before the fifth day of the Lunar New Year, which is also to let others have a safe New Year, no matter when you have to talk about it after the New Year, and others are also convenient for yourself, and be more considerate of others.

    11. During the Spring Festival, it is best not to break the glass and ceramics, so as not to break the fortune and bad luck, which is a well-known taboo.
